Review of Frequency Doubling Crystal in High Power CO2 Lasers
The methods to produce mid-infrared lasers and the features of different mid-infrared lasers are introduced. Combined with the advantages of the second harmonic generation in CO2 laser, the performance of frequency doubling crystals in the CO2 laser are mainly discussed. The performances of the most widely used birefringent phase matching (BPM) and quasi phase matching (QPM) frequency doubling crystals are compared and analyzed. The problems and probable techniques for the development of second harmonic generation in CO2 laser are previewed.
